When choosing premium wooden pallets, several key functions need to be thought about:
Wood Grade: Quality wood types, such as hardwood or treated softwood, are more durable and can bring heavier loads.Production Standards: Regulations such as ISPM-15 ensure that wooden pallets are treated to avoid pest invasions.Style and Construction: Sturdiness can be guaranteed by searching for pallets with a strong block design, as opposed to a stringer style, which might not provide the same weight assistance.Nail Quality: High-quality pallets use steel nails that are resistant to deterioration, guaranteeing the structural stability of the pallet gradually.Table 2: Key Features to Look for in High-Quality Wooden PalletsFeatureDescriptionWood GradeState-of-the-art hardwood or dealt with softwoodManufacturing StandardsCompliance with ISPM-15 regulationsDesignStrong block vs. stringer styleNail QualityUse of corrosion-resistant steel nailsBenefits of Choosing High-Quality Wooden Pallets

2. Are all wooden pallets treated for pests?
No, not all wooden pallets are dealt with. It is essential to search for pallets that abide by ISPM-15 requirements to ensure they are pest-resistant.
